In 1920, Lowell W. Dougherty entered the world in Virginia, born to Nathan Arnett Dougherty And Orpha Edna Harris. In 1930, Lowell W. Dougherty resided in Rivanna, Albemarle, Virginia. In 1935, Lowell W. Dougherty resided in Johnson, Scott, Virginia. Lowell W. Dougherty passed away in 2008 in Kingsport, Sullivan County, Tennessee, USA.
